Uses
- Helps relieve the itching and discomfort associated with hemorrhoids, inflamed hemorrhoidal tissues, anorectal disorders and anorectal inflammation
- Temporarily protects irritated areas
- Temporarily provides a coating for relief of anorectal discomforts
- Temporarily protects the inflamed, irritated anorectal surface to help make bowel movements less painful
- Temporarily relieves the symptoms of perianal skin irritation
- Temporarily protects inflamed perianal skin
- For the temporary relief of pain or burning
- May provide a cooling sensation

Warnings
- For external and/or intrarectal use only
- When using this product
if condition worsens or does not improve within 7 days, consult a doctor
do not exceed the recommended daily dosage unless directed by a doctor
in case of bleeding, consult a doctor promptly- Do not insert the applicator into the rectum if it causes additional pain. Consult a doctor promptly.
If Pregnant or Breastfeeding, ask a healthcare provider before using.
Keep out of reach of children. If sw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.

Directions
- adults: when practical, cleanse the affected area by patting or blotting with an appropriate cleansing wipe. Gently dry by blotting or patting with a tissue or a soft cloth before applying ointment.
- Apply to the affected area up to 6 times daily, especially at night, in the morning or after ' each bowel movement.
- EXTERNAL USE: Apply to external anal area.
- INTRARECTAL USE: Lubricate applicator well with Lonazem ointment, then gently insert applicator into the rectum.
- Children under 12 years of age: consult a doctor
